Deposit Match Percentages and Maximum Caps Explained

A deposit match percentage, like a 100% match, directly doubles your initial deposit up to a set ceiling. That ceiling is the maximum cap explained as the absolute dollar limit the casino will bonus. For example, a 100% match up to $500 means a $200 deposit yields a $200 bonus, but a $600 deposit only provides a $500 bonus, not $600. Players should always calculate their deposit against the cap to maximize the match. Lower percentages, such as 50%, halve your bonus potential, while higher caps allow for larger total playable funds. Focusing on the stated percentage and its cap ensures you fully leverage the offer’s true value.

Breaking Down Wagering Requirements Without the Jargon

When you land a casino bonus promising fifty free spins, the fine print often hides a catch: wagering requirements. Instead of tossing around terms like “playthrough coefficient,” picture this: you claim a $10 bonus with a 30x requirement. That means you must bet $300 in total before any winnings become cash you can withdraw. If you spin a slot at $1 per go, you’ll need 300 spins—not 30. The real context is math disguised as a rule.

Always check the multiplier: a 20x requirement on a $10 bonus requires $200 in bets, not a quick $20 win.

Every spin chips away at that total, but only bets count—not your balance after a win. So, track your wagered amount, not your luck.

How to Calculate Playthrough Before You Commit

Before you accept a casino bonus, calculate the total wagering requirement by multiplying the bonus amount by the playthrough multiplier. For example, a $100 bonus with 35x playthrough means you must wager $3,500. Then check if slots contribute 100%, but table games might count only 10–20%, which drastically increases the real playthrough. Always divide the total play by your average bet size to see how many spins or hands you’ll need. Smart playthrough calculation protects your bankroll before you stake a single spin.

  • Multiply the bonus by the playthrough multiplier to get the total wager target.
  • Check game contribution percentages—slots often count fully, but other games may add hidden wagering weight.
  • Divide the total play requirement by your typical bet size to estimate realistic completion time.

Time Limits and Expiration Dates That Trap Newcomers

Newcomers often miss that most casino bonuses impose a tight wagering deadline, typically ranging from 7 to 30 days. Once the offer is claimed, the clock starts immediately, requiring you to meet turnover requirements before the cutoff. If you fail to complete wagering within this period, the bonus and any associated winnings simply vanish. This trap is exacerbated by expiration dates on specific games, where free spins or bonus funds deactivate if unused within 24–72 hours. Below is a comparison of common time constraints:

Time Limit Type Duration Common Consequence for Newcomers
Wagering deadline 7–30 days Bonus and winnings forfeited
Free spin expiry 24–72 hours Unused spins removed
Deposit-linked expiration Starts on first deposit Partial cancellation of offer

Ignoring these dates forces you to either forfeit the bonus or rush play under pressure, often leading to losses. Always check the terms for “valid until” stamps and set personal reminders.

Weekly Cashback Offers: Real Money vs. Bonus Credits

Weekly cashback offers typically return a percentage of net losses as either real money or bonus credits. Real money cashback is immediately withdrawable and carries no wagering requirement, offering direct value. Bonus credits, however, often require playthrough conditions (e.g., 10x-40x) before withdrawal, reducing their effective worth. Checking the terms clarifies if cashback counts toward loyalty tier progression or excludes specific games. Prioritize real money offers for liquidity, but note that bonus credit amounts are frequently higher.

Weekly cashback in real money is instantly usable, while bonus credits lock funds behind wagering requirements, making withdrawable cashback the more valuable option for returning players.

Reading the Fine Print: Sticky Bonuses and Max Bet Limits

Before claiming a sign-up gift, scrutinize the terms for sticky bonus restrictions and max bet limits. A sticky bonus is a phantom credit that remains locked in your account until you meet wagering, meaning you cannot withdraw it directly—only the winnings it generates. Simultaneously, max bet limits cap your wager per spin or hand while the bonus is active; exceeding even a penny can void your entire bonus and winnings. These two rules work together to prevent quick cash-outs.

  • Always confirm if the bonus is “sticky” before depositing—it affects withdrawal strategy.
  • Check the max bet limit (typically €5 or less) and never exceed it.
  • Avoid placing large single bets; spread your play to stay under the cap.

Accelerated Playthrough Triggers and Withdrawal Holds

Accelerated playthrough triggers occur when a deposit made to satisfy a bonus’s minimum requirement resets or shortens the wagering period on a separate active bonus, often without explicit warning. This rush forces players to complete playthrough faster than expected, increasing the likelihood of losses. Withdrawal holds then lock funds if that accelerated bonus is not fully met before the new deadline. Combining multiple bonuses can inadvertently activate these triggers, trapping winnings behind cascading wagering demands.

Q: How can I avoid accelerated playthrough triggers?
A: Always read bonus terms for “stacking” or “concurrent bonus” policies, and only activate one bonus at a time to prevent unwitting speed-ups and holds.
